How Common Is The Last Name Tjipto?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 405,848th most commonly held family name worldwide, held by around 1 in 8,444,433 people. The surname occurs predominantly in Asia, where 97 percent of Tjipto reside; 97 percent reside in Southeast Asia and 95 percent reside in Malayo-Arabic Southeast Asia. Tjipto is also the 156,143rd most widely held given name globally. It is borne by 2,282 people.
It is most numerous in Indonesia, where it is carried by 819 people, or 1 in 161,476. In Indonesia Tjipto is most numerous in: Jakarta, where 23 percent live, East Java, where 22 percent live and Central Java, where 12 percent live. Excluding Indonesia it exists in 7 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 2 percent live and Singapore, where 2 percent live.
